He’s r/VolunteersForUkraine’s top financial resource.

, the US government has requested that American citizens abstain from traveling to Ukraine to defend the nation from Russia.

One user wrote to the community looking for advice on how to pause bill payments. “I’m flying out to Ukraine next week, but that doesn’t make bills go away,” one user wrote. “I’m going regardless, just wondering if there’s anything I can do so I’m only half fucked if I come back.”Capone’s LinkedIn post circulated heavily in these Reddit communities, often naming him as a direct source for funding.
